Disposal

Professional waste disposal of waste of all types is one of the most important subjects of our time. Here, so-called secondary raw materials and final waste must basically be differentiated between. By secondary raw materials are meant all materials which are used for recycling processes after their throughput as basic materials for the manufacture of new products. The utilization of pure building rubble can be designated here as an example. By pure building rubble is meant bricks and concrete parts resulting from the demolition of buildings which must be disposed of as debris. This building rubble is transported in a recycling system and comminuted there in gigantic grinding equipment, in order to be then employed as ballast in road and rail construction. Final waste in turn must be either incinerated or finally stored in suitable refuse dumps.
